Wax First or Glaze First
I'm doing my annual Z hand waxing. Does the glaze go on before or after the new wax---or does it really matter?
|
Glaze after washing, clay before polishing or glazing, waxing or sealing is the last step. Check out autogeek's website to get you into the ultimate car care mode, the detailing section on this site is good too! :tiphat:

Wash, clay if necessary, polish if necessary, Glaze, Wax.
|
Glaze is old school. It's loaded with fillers and only lasts a few weeks. Polish your clear coat properly, then use wax or sealant.
|
Glaze then wax. Glazes offer no real longevity unless they are topped with a wax, which will also amplify the shine and depth the glaze gives.
